On 13.01.2024 01:57, Timo Rothenpieler wrote:
> FFmpeg has instances of DECLARE_ALIGNED(32, ...) in a lot of structs,
> which then end up heap-allocated.
> By declaring any variable in a struct, or tree of structs, to be 32 byte
> aligned, it allows the compiler to safely assume the entire struct
> itself is also 32 byte aligned.
>
> This might make the compiler emit code which straight up crashes or
> misbehaves in other ways, and at least in one instances is now
> documented to actually do (see ticket 10549 on trac).
> The issue there is that an unrelated variable in SingleChannelElement is
> declared to have an alignment of 32 bytes. So if the compiler does a copy
> in decode_cpe() with avx instructions, but ffmpeg is built with
> --disable-avx, this results in a crash, since the memory is only 16 byte
> aligned.
>
> Mind you, even if the compiler does not emit avx instructions, the code
> is still invalid and could misbehave. It just happens not to. Declaring
> any variable in a struct with a 32 byte alignment promises 32 byte
> alignment of the whole struct to the compiler.
>
> This patch limits the maximum alignment to the maximum possible simd
> alignment according to configure.
> While not perfect, it at the very least gets rid of a lot of UB, by
> matching up the maximum DECLARE_ALIGNED value with the alignment of heap
> allocations done by lavu.

The issue with this approach is that code that previously allowed the
compiler to optimize it heavily will now only be optimized if ffmpeg was
built without disabling avx.
Probably a fair tradeoff though, since that's a very niche case.
I also did not test this with MSVC or ICC, so I have no idea if they
allow FFMIN in the middle of an alignment attribute.
